Mrs. Lula Mae Summerour Sims passed away on Wednesday, February 1, 2012 at the age of 95. She was preceded in death by her husband, Maurice Othel Sims and son, Phillip Lawrence Sims. She is survived by her daughter, Elaine Gail Spencer and grandchildren, Danielle Marie Sims and Phillip Maurice Sims. Mrs. Sims was a life-time resident of Georgia and resided in Conyers for over 30 years. She lived through difficult times during the Great Depression and World War II but those experiences helped make her a strong and resilient person. Her longevity can be attributed to her great sense of humor and a positive outlook on life. She was a loving, kind and patient person who will be missed greatly.
